Property Description

This cheery home, with its open City views and abundant light, welcomes you right in. With abundant closet space (including a walk-in closet), a separate dining alcove, and windowed kitchen this apartment has all the small additions that make living in NYC a pleasure. Facing the back of the building, yet clearing all the surrounding buildings, this home boasts the rare combination of abundant light and quiet, not to mention townhouse, City, and tree line views... all in one place! This may be a prewar building, but all the touches within the apartment are contemporary from the recently updated kitchen with new appliances to the newly painted walls. The living room is double sized and, with the addition of the dining alcove, you will have the space to lounge, work, dine, and entertain in style. The bedroom, too, is spacious and bright. Come and see for yourself. And then head up to the roofdeck to enjoy a beautifully landscaped urban garden. This pre war building, located in the beautiful Turtle Bay Gardens Historical District, comes staffed with a live in super and doorman (7:30AM to 11:30pm). The building allows guarantors, peids a terre, co purchasing, and parents buying for children. Subletting is allowed after three years of residency for two years. Pets are not permitted. $88.51/m assessment in place.
